Responding to the International Olympic Committee’s refusal to hold a moment of silence at this summer’s London games for the 40th anniversary of 11 Israeli team members killed by Palestinian terrorists in Munich, sportscaster Bob Costas said he will recognize the Israelis when he covers the Olympics for NBC.
“I intend to note that the IOC denied the request,” Costas told The Hollywood Reporter. “Many people find that denial more than puzzling but insensitive. Here’s a minute of silence right now.”
